AI Summary

  • Requires all Illinois public school students in grades 6 through 12 to receive career and technical education instruction beginning with the 2027-2028 school year
  • Allows the instruction requirement to be satisfied by attending a field trip to a local career and technical education training center
  • Permits school boards to integrate the required instruction into existing courses, provided it is delivered annually to all students in grades 6-12
  • Gives each school board authority to determine the minimum amount of instructional time required for compliance
  • State Mandates Act may require reimbursement to school districts for implementation costs
